Fyodor Mikhailovich Dostoyevsky (1821-1881) is often regarded as the stereotypical Russian novelist: the author of huge, intense, philosophical works that make it onto every list of the world’s greatest novels, but are perhaps few people’s idea of fun. But this reputation ignores the great variety of his writing. This bilingual presentation of some of the author\'s least known works offers a fresh look at the famous author.
